LOC100294254 GI:239740830 PREDICTED: hypothetical protein XP_002344068 1 msqktsplne plfqelvkfp stvksvglfl qlnpnasste tqllvpales 50 51 rdtlppthcf magtesplgn pwplslpppc wtgcvlpapr gqrkpgplgl 100 101 sifislgnkr hrsgnhvvre seqplsqgnp hqgwgpdtrk gr